Projects to Build Your Ice Sculpting Skills
Ice sculpting is a dynamic and rewarding art form that combines creativity, technical skill, and an understanding of your medium’s unique properties. Whether you’re holding a chisel for the first time or refining advanced techniques, this curated collection of projects will guide your progression from foundational basics to impressive sculptural mastery. Each project builds upon previous skills while introducing new challenges and artistic possibilities.
Beginner Projects Months 1-3
Basic Ice Block Familiarization ⭐
Start by learning how ice behaves in different temperatures and light conditions. Create simple geometric shapes like cubes, spheres, and pyramids. This 2-3 hour project teaches you fundamental tool control and ice fracture patterns.
Simple Ice Lantern ⭐
Hollow out the interior of an ice block to create a functional lantern. This 4-5 hour project introduces depth carving and teaches you how to work safely without breaking through walls. Perfect for seasonal decoration.
Animal Head Study ⭐
Carve a simple animal profile like a swan, fish, or bird head from a standard ice block. This 5-6 hour project develops your understanding of proportions and organic shapes while keeping complexity manageable.
Textured Surface Techniques ⭐
Experiment with different surface treatments including crosshatching, stippling, and smooth polishing on a single block. This 3-4 hour exploratory project teaches you how surface texture affects light reflection and visual interest.
Basic Ice Vase ⭐
Create a functional vase suitable for holding flowers by carefully hollowing and smoothing the interior. This 6-7 hour project combines practical utility with artistic expression and teaches precision carving.
Ice Torch or Column ⭐
Build a vertical structure decorated with carved bands or patterns. This 4-5 hour project teaches you structural stability and how to work vertically while managing ice weight and balance.
Greeting Card Ice Sculpture ⭐
Carve a small block featuring initials, dates, or simple messages for a special occasion. This 3-4 hour project introduces lettering and personalization while remaining forgiving for beginners.
Fruit or Vegetable Ice Cast ⭐
Create an ice block by freezing actual fruit or vegetables inside, then carve around them to highlight the frozen contents. This 5-6 hour project teaches planning and working with embedded elements.
Basic Bowl or Cup ⭐
Hollow out a simple drinking vessel or decorative bowl with smooth walls and finished edges. This 5-6 hour project emphasizes precision and teaches you to maintain consistent wall thickness throughout.
Seasonal Snowflake Design ⭐
Carve an intricate snowflake pattern into a flat or slightly dimensional ice slab. This 4-5 hour project develops fine detail work and symmetry skills while producing beautiful decorative pieces.
Intermediate Projects Months 3-12
Multi-Block Connected Sculpture ⭐⭐
Join two or three ice blocks together using water or adhesive techniques to create a larger composition. This 8-10 hour project teaches you structural engineering and how to work with scale.
Realistic Animal Figure ⭐⭐
Carve a full-body animal like a penguin, dolphin, or horse with anatomical accuracy and fine details. This 12-15 hour project develops your understanding of form, proportion, and complex geometry.
Ice Bar or Beverage Station ⭐⭐
Design and carve a functional bar structure with multiple elements, shelves, and decorative details. This 15-20 hour project combines artistic vision with practical functionality for events.
Human Portrait or Bust ⭐⭐
Carve a recognizable portrait or bust capturing facial features and expressions. This 15-18 hour project teaches facial anatomy, proportion, and the challenge of creating likenesses.
Illuminated Ice Sculpture with Lighting ⭐⭐
Create a sculpture specifically designed to be lit from within or behind, using color-changing LED lights. This 10-14 hour project teaches you how to design for light refraction and dramatic visual effects.
Abstract Flowing Form ⭐⭐
Interpret an emotion or concept through flowing, curved lines without representing anything specific. This 12-16 hour project develops artistic vision and teaches you to work without a literal subject.
Historical or Mythological Figure ⭐⭐
Carve a character from mythology, history, or literature with costume details and contextual elements. This 15-20 hour project combines historical research with sculptural skill.
Interactive Ice Installation ⭐⭐
Design ice sculptures that guests can interact with, touch, or move around during an event. This 14-18 hour project teaches you about durability, safety, and audience engagement.
Nature Scene Composition ⭐⭐
Create a narrative scene with multiple elements like trees, animals, landscape features, or water formations. This 18-24 hour project teaches composition, spatial relationships, and storytelling.
Ice Furniture Piece ⭐⭐
Carve a functional furniture item like a chair, table, or bench that can support weight safely. This 20-25 hour project combines engineering, safety considerations, and design thinking.
Advanced Projects 12+ Months
Large-Scale Installation (5+ Blocks) ⭐⭐⭐
Plan and execute a major installation combining multiple ice blocks into a cohesive artistic statement. This 40-60 hour project requires advanced planning, team coordination, and artistic vision at a professional level.
Competition Carving (90-120 Minutes) ⭐⭐⭐
Prepare an entry for ice carving competitions with strict time limits and complex requirements. This ongoing project teaches you speed, confidence, and the ability to execute flawlessly under pressure.
Custom Commission Piece ⭐⭐⭐
Accept a client commission with specific requirements, timeline, and artistic direction. This 30-50 hour project teaches you professional communication, project management, and the ability to translate vision into reality.
Experimental Hybrid Media Sculpture ⭐⭐⭐
Combine ice with other materials like glass, metal, wood, or colored ice to create innovative artistic statements. This 25-40 hour project pushes boundaries and develops your unique artistic voice.
Master Series Portfolio ⭐⭐⭐
Create a cohesive series of 3-5 sculptures exploring a specific theme, technique, or artistic concept. This 60+ hour project develops your signature style and demonstrates mastery across multiple pieces.
